Next To Herbie Mann i would have to say that Gerald Beckett is one of the better Flute players i have listened to, and especially on the newer age front. So nice to hear someone producing music like this and putting the flute to good use. I was actually quite surprised at how good it sounded overall. Pretty neat little cover of "So What" from Miles Davis. He also does a few other covers as well on the album, which are unique in their own way as they are primarily jazz/world music tunes and put their Flute Spin on them. Not too bad overall.
